How do I know if I have a tick infestation?

For four weeks, a puppy with lots of ticks stayed in one room of my house. During the first week, I found and removed a blood-engorged tick that was crawling up the wall. I also saw another tick on the floor and removed it. Five days after the puppy was gone, I found a mature brown dog tick crawling up the molding around a door. Three days later, I found another one on the floor of the opposite side of the room, near the baseboard. In the five days since the last tick, I have not seen any more. Three days ago, I set up a dry ice trap for 3 hours in the room, and it did not attract any ticks. Could I have a tick infestation?

Answer:

We would recommend speaking with a local pest control operator to see the extent of the infestation if there is one. We would also recommend treating the area once you do have an answer.
